It 'obvious that the term" moving mountains "should not be taken literally. Jesus promised the disciples power to do spectacular miracles to impress the crowd. And in fact, if you go to look in the history of the Church, you will not find a saint - I know - I've moved mountains with faith. "Moving Mountains" is hyperbole, that is an exaggerated figure of speech, to inculcate in the minds of the disciples to faith, the concept that nothing is impossible.
Every miracle that Jesus worked, directly or through her, has always been done on the basis of the Kingdom of God or the Gospel or the salvation of men. Moving a mountain would not help this.
The comparison with the "mustard seed" is a sign that Jesus do not demand a faith more or less, but an authentic faith. And the characteristic of true faith is to be based solely on God and not about your ability.
If you doubt the axle ol'esitazione in faith means that your trust in God is not yet complete: you have a weak faith and ineffective, which is still leveraging your strengths and human logic.
Those who trust entirely in God, let him act the same ... and for God nothing is impossible.
The faith that Jesus wants the disciples is just full of confidence that attitude that allows God to manifest his power.
And this faith, which means they can move mountains, is not restricted to a few exceptional person. It is possible and necessary for all believers.
